How Fast Does Grass Grow in Rochester Hills, Michigan?
Understanding grass growth rates in Michigan is key to choosing the right mowing frequency. Rochester Hills lawns consist primarily of cool-season grasses (Kentucky bluegrass, perennial ryegrass, fine fescue) that have distinct growth patterns throughout the year.
Michigan Grass Growth Seasons
Peak Growth (April-May & September-October): Cool-season grasses thrive when temperatures are 60-75°F. During these periods, Rochester Hills lawns can grow 1.5-2 inches per week or even more with adequate rainfall. This rapid growth is why weekly lawn service in Rochester Hills is essential during spring and early fall.
Summer Slow-Down (July-August): When temperatures exceed 85°F and rainfall decreases, grass growth slows to about 0.5-1 inch per week. This is the only period when bi-weekly mowing might work for some lawns.
Fall Resurgence (September-November): As temperatures cool, grass rebounds with another growth spurt of 1-1.5 inches per week until frost arrives.
Benefits of Weekly Lawn Mowing in Rochester Hills
1. Healthier Grass
Weekly lawn service ensures you never violate the one-third rule, even during peak spring growth in Michigan. When grass is cut too short (scalped), it:
- Weakens the plant and root system
- Creates brown, stressed appearance
- Makes lawn vulnerable to disease and pests
- Allows weed seeds better access to soil and sunlight
- Reduces drought tolerance during summer heat
Weekly lawn mowing in Rochester Hills maintains consistent height, promoting thick, healthy turf that naturally resists weeds and disease.

Challenges of Bi-Weekly Lawn Service
Spring Growth Problem
In April and May, Rochester Hills lawns can grow 2+ inches per week. If your grass is at 3 inches before mowing and grows 2 inches, it's now 5 inches tall. Cutting back to proper height (2.5-3 inches) means removing 40-50% of grass height - far exceeding the one-third rule.
This is why weekly lawn service Rochester Hills residents rely on during spring provides better results than bi-weekly scheduling.

When Bi-Weekly Mowing Might Work
There are limited situations where bi-weekly lawn service in Rochester Hills makes sense:
Mid-Summer Drought Period
During July and August, if Rochester Hills experiences hot, dry weather with minimal rain, grass growth slows significantly. Some homeowners switch to bi-weekly service during this 4-6 week window, then resume weekly service in fall.
Mature, Slow-Growing Lawns
Some established Rochester Hills lawns with dense shade or mature trees grow more slowly year-round and can sustain bi-weekly mowing without compromising health or appearance.
Budget Constraints
If budget is the primary concern, bi-weekly service is better than no professional service at all. However, many homeowners find the marginal cost increase for weekly service worth the significant improvement in results.

Will weekly mowing wear out my grass?
No - proper weekly mowing actually strengthens grass by following the one-third rule and promoting thick, lateral growth. The stress comes from cutting too much at once (bi-weekly problem), not from cutting frequently.
